  19. Embankment Design

  20. Dam Dimensions • Dam storage volume is 600000 CM. • Max. length for the dam is 170m. • Max. width of the dam is 103m. • Max. height of the dam is 15m. • Crest width is 6m. • Side slope for upstream is 3.5:1 • Side slope for Downstream is 3:1

  25. Spillway Geometry • Q = 1.7 B H1.5 • C (discharge coefficient) is 1.7 • B (width of spillway) is 10m • H (design head) is 2.4m • The length of spillway is 250m • Elevation Difference is 30m

  26. Stilling basin Design • Stilling basin length is 55m • Water depth before stilling is 0.5m • Water depth after hydraulic jump is 13m

  27. Outlet Design • Pipe diameter is 12inch. • Pipe slope is 2%. • Pipe capacity is 0.58 m3 / s.
